Hi,
I'm thinking of building my first connector using the Connector Builder, but there's a few questions I have that are not covered in the documentation.
1. Does my connector have to be published to all Domo customers, or can I limit my connector to customers I choose?
2. If I need to publish updates to my connector, do they take effect immediately or is there a delay?
3. The IDE makes no apparent provision for configuration (for example, selecting fields, specifying date ranges or entering filter criteria). Is there any way within the IDE to configure a form that supplies additional variables to the data processing script?
4. What limits exist on the data processing script? Is there a lines-of-code limit, or an execution timeout limit?
5. Who handles technical support for a custom connector? Does Domo take ownership and support responsibility of the submitted code, or does that remain with the publisher? In that event, how are support requests for a custom connector relayed to the publisher for resolution?
6. As a publisher, do I get any insights into how many installs, runs, records, cards and issues arise out of the use of my connector on customer instances?
7. What is Domo's position on building connectors for systems that "already exist"? For example, Wufoo Forms - there's a connector for it, but it does not retrieve actual survey responses. Under what criteria will Domo typically reject a connector for publication?
8. Why is there no Google AdWords connector? Google has a robust API, and connectors for other Google products exist, so I'm confused as to why there's no AdWords connector. I was thinking of building a simple one before I realized that there might be a good reason why there isn't one.
9. Under what conditions can I cancel/un-publish/remove a connector from circulation?